What are UPVC Windows and Doors?

UPVC windows and doors are made from a robust and long lasting product called unplasticized polyvinyl chloride. Unlike traditional materials like wood or aluminum, UPVC is understood for its resistance to weathering, rust, and chemical damage. These functions make UPVC a perfect choice for modern-day homes, combining both functionality and aesthetic appeal.

Advantages of UPVC Windows and Doors

UPVC doors and windows use a wide range of advantages, making them a preferred choice among property owners and home builders. Some of these advantages include:

  1. Energy Efficiency:

    • UPVC doors and windows have exceptional thermal insulation homes, preventing heat loss during winter season and heat entry in summertime. This can significantly lower energy bills.
  2. Enhanced Security:

    • Many upvc Windows doors profiles featured multi-point locking systems and enhanced structures that supply increased security against burglaries.
  3. Low Maintenance:

    • Unlike wood, which requires routine painting and treatment, UPVC does not require frequent maintenance. Cleaning up is as easy as cleaning with a damp fabric.
  4. Visual Appeal:

    • UPVC doors and windows can be personalized to match any architectural design and can be found in different colors and finishes, consisting of wood-grain results, supplying the wanted visual without the typical drawbacks of wood.
  5. Noise Reduction:

    • The airtight seal of UPVC frames assists to obstruct out external noise, including a component of tranquility to the living environment.
  6. Cost-Effective:

    • Although the preliminary financial investment may be slightly higher than conventional windows and doors, the long-lasting cost savings on upkeep and energy expenses make UPVC an affordable choice.

Setup of UPVC Windows and Doors

The installation procedure of UPVC windows and doors is crucial for ensuring their performance and longevity. Here's an overview of the actions involved:

Step-by-Step Installation Process

  1. Measurement:

    • Accurate measurements of window and door openings are important to guaranteeing an ideal fit.
  2. Preparation:

    • Remove any existing frames and prepare the openings by cleaning and leveling the surface areas.
  3. Dry Fit:

    • Place the UPVC frames into the openings without fastening them to look for fit and guarantee that they are level.
  4. Protecting the Frame:

    • Once appropriately fitted, the frames are protected using screws or other fasteners, ensuring they are sealed tightly.
  5. Sealing:

    • Apply appropriate sealants to prevent air and water seepage, additional enhancing the energy efficiency of the setup.
  6. Ending up Touches:

    • Install trims or ending up pieces to offer the installation a refined look.

Maintenance of UPVC Windows and Doors

Though UPVC requires very little maintenance, proper care can guarantee longevity and optimal performance. Here are some maintenance tips:

Maintenance Tips for UPVC Windows and Doors

  • Routine Cleaning: Use moderate detergents with water to clean up the frames and glass.
  • Inspect Seals and Hinges: Regularly examine weather condition seals and hinges and change them if worn or harmed.
  • Lubrication: Apply a silicon-based lubricant to moving parts like locks and hinges to guarantee smooth operation.
  • Check for Damage: Periodically check for any indications of damage or wear and address issues promptly.

Frequently Asked Questions About UPVC Windows and Doors

Q1: How long do UPVC windows and doors last?

A1: UPVC doors and windows can last approximately 25 years or longer, depending upon the quality of the materials and upkeep.

Q2: Are UPVC windows energy effective?

A2: Yes, UPVC doors and windows offer outstanding insulation, assisting to reduce energy bills and maintain indoor convenience.

Q3: Can UPVC windows and doors be painted?

A3: While painting UPVC is possible, it is typically not recommended as it can void service warranties. UPVC is offered in different finishes that do not require painting.

Q4: Are UPVC windows protect?

A4: Yes, UPVC doors and windows come with multi-point locking systems and can be enhanced for added security.

Q5: How do UPVC windows compare with wood windows?

A5: UPVC windows are typically more resilient, require less maintenance, and supply better insulation compared to wooden windows, which are more vulnerable to rot and require regular maintenance.
